1. A wireless communication device for transmitting and receiving a signal having a first frequency for communication, the wireless communication device comprising:
a loop pattern;
a first electrode configured as a first end of the loop pattern;
a second electrode arranged at an interval from the first electrode and configured as a second end of the loop pattern;
an antenna pattern connected to the loop pattern;
a third electrode capacitively coupled to the first electrode;
a fourth electrode capacitively coupled to the second electrode;
an RFIC having a capacitive impedance at a second frequency higher than the first frequency; and
a first current path and a second current path connected in parallel with each other between the third electrode and the fourth electrode,
wherein the RFIC is included in the first current path, and the second current path has an inductive impedance at a second frequency.
